Which of the following describes a technology that can convert spoken words into text?

Explanation:
The technology that can convert spoken words into text is known as speech recognition. This involves using algorithms to analyze audio signals, identifying words and phrases as they are spoken, and transcribing them into written form. Speech recognition systems utilize techniques from fields such as signal processing and natural language processing to improve accuracy and understand variations in accents, intonations, and speech patterns. Natural language processing, while related, focuses more on enabling computers to understand and generate human language rather than the input of spoken words in an audio format. Computer vision pertains to the analysis and interpretation of visual information from the world, which is unrelated to audio processing. Robotics involves the design and application of robots and does not inherently involve the conversion of speech to text. Thus, the focus of speech recognition specifically addresses the task of transforming vocal expressions into readable text, making it the correct choice in this context.

Common Content Areas

The content of the FBLA Data Science & AI exam can be categorized into several key areas:

  1. Data Analysis: Understanding data types, data cleaning, and data visualization techniques.
  2. Machine Learning: Basic concepts of supervised and unsupervised learning, algorithms, and model evaluation.
  3. AI Principles: Fundamental artificial intelligence concepts, including natural language processing and neural networks.
  4. Statistical Methods: Knowledge of descriptive and inferential statistics relevant to data interpretation.
  5. Ethical Considerations: Awareness of ethical issues in data science and AI, such as bias and privacy.

Familiarizing yourself with these areas will enhance your ability to tackle the exam effectively.
